抄録 | ||||||
内容記述タイプ | Abstract | |||||
内容記述 | 水稲根系からの出液速度および出液中に含まれるサイトカイニン(t-ZR)含有量を酵素抗体法(ELIZA法)を用いて定量した.有機資材を連続施用した圃場のコシヒカリは, 出穂期におけるサイトカイニン含有量が高い傾向を示した.長野県伊那市の多収コシヒカリではサイトカイニン含有量が高く, 根の活力は高いものと考えられる.最高分げつ期前後の出液速度と茎数および地上部乾重との間には, 有意な正の相関関係が認められた.出液速度と株間の根乾重との間に, 有意な相関関係は認められなかった.塩粳48号とコシヒカリとの間には, サイトカイニン含有量に関して品種間差異が認められた. Cytokinin content in the bleeding sap of paddy rice was analized using ELIZA method (Trans-Zeatin Riboside Immunoassay Detection Kit). t-ZR content in the bleeding sap of rice growm with continuous organic fertilizers applications was high compared to conventional rice. Cytokinin content of Koshihikari grown in Ina city was extremely high. It may be recognized that root of rice grown in Ina city keeps high physiological activity. There were a significant positive correlations between bleeding sap and stem number per plant, aboveground dry weight per plant, respectivery. There was no significant correlation between root dry weight of interhill space and bleeding sap. | |||||
